The strategy has the following options:
Option | Default | Description |
---|---|---|
| | Base directory where temporary files for spooled streams should be stored. This option supports naming patterns as documented below. |
| | Size in bytes when the stream should be spooled to disk instead of keeping in memory. Use a value of 0 or negative to disable it all together so streams is always kept in memory regardless of their size. |
| | If set, the temporary files are encrypted using the specified cipher transformation (i.e., a valid stream or 8-bit cipher name such as "RC4", "AES/CTR/NoPadding". An empty name "" is treated as null). |
| | Size in bytes of the buffer used when copying streams. |
| | Whether to remove the spool directory when stopping CamelContext. |

The following patterns is supported:
- #uuid# = a random UUID
- #camelId# = the CamelContext id (eg the name)
- #name# - same as #camelId#
- #counter# - an incrementing counter
- #bundleId# - the OSGi bundle id (only for OSGi environments)
- #symbolicName# - the OSGi symbolic name (only for OSGi environments)
- #version# - the OSGi bundle version (only for OSGi environments)
- ${env:key} - the environment variable with the key
- ${key} - the JVM system property with the key
